Analyis of the race

OASIS DAVIS got off the mark in good fashion for the in-form David Marnane. As the leaders made the turn into the home straight, nothing was going better than the winner and, still travelling well at the 2f marker, he challenged Caherassdotcom over 1f out before going away. Having been just outdone in a three-year-old handicap at Leopardstown nine days earlier on similarly fast ground, Oasis Davis clearly acts on this surface after some below-par efforts on slower conditions in Britain last season.

Caherassdotcom did her best to make this a good test, having taken up the running in the early stages. She still led passing the 2f marker, but was challenged over 1f out by the winner and had no answer. This was a much better effort than her Tipperary reappearance and first-time blinkers seemed to help

. Rose Rouge never managed to get seriously involved before staying on inside the final furlong to finish fourth, while Toberanthawn looked sure to finish in the first three approaching the 1f marker but faded badly to finish fifth.

The second of the Ballydoyle horses, Egyptian Hero , a well-bred son of Danzig, was always struggling from the outset and looked reluctant in the early stages before beating just two horses home.
